Snow Showers and Squalls Expected This Weekend in New York
Areas of heavy snow and low visibility likely on Saturday morning
Published on Feb. 6, 2026
Got story updates? Submit your updates here. ›
A weather system is expected to bring snow showers and potential squalls to parts of Vermont and northern New York this weekend, with the heaviest snow and lowest visibility likely on Saturday morning.
Why it matters
Heavy snow and poor visibility can create dangerous driving conditions, leading to potential travel disruptions and safety concerns for residents in the affected areas.
The details
The incoming weather system is expected to bring a mix of snow showers and squalls to the region, with the potential for areas of heavy snowfall and reduced visibility, especially on Saturday morning.
